
Upon leaving the University of Miami, Woody Bennett entered the National Football League. He began his professional year in 1979 with the
New York Jets, in 1980 he was signed by the Miami Dolphins playing with the likes of Dan Marino, Mark Duper, Mark Clayton, Nat Moore and many other football greats under the tutelage of one the greatest coaches of all times, Mr. Don Shula.
